Review: Logitech Combo Touch Keyboard Case with Trackpad for iPad 7 [Video] - Latest News

Yesterday I received my hands on the most recent iPad 7 computer keyboard case offering: the Logitech Combo Touch Keyboard Case with Trackpad. This $149. 95 case features an integrated trackpad to make the most of the new cursor control in iPadOS 13.4.

If you have a 7th-generation iPad (review), this is one of the most useful accessories you can purchase out of the Apple Pencil. Specifications

  • Constructed in multi-touch trackpad
  • Backlit keys
  • Full row of iPadOS shortcut keys
  • Constructed in multi-angle kick stand with 50-level tilt
  • Four usage modes optimized for typing, viewing, reading, and sketching
  • Apple Pencil (1st-gen) / Logitech Crayon holder
  • Smart Connector for power and connectivity
  • Protective instance covers front, back, and sides of iPad
  • Also available for iPad Air 3
  • $149. 95 price

Unboxing and installation

Within the box you’ll find the two components which compose the keyboard case: a protective cover, and the keyboard part that attaches magnetically to the bottom of the iPad.

Installing the Logitech Keyboard Case about the iPad 7 is as simple as lining up the tablet properly with the rear protective cap, and pressing down so that the borders that wrap around the iPad lock it into position.

From there, it is only a matter of attaching the computer keyboard to the Smart Connector portion of this iPad.  What you’ll wind up with is a computer keyboard case that completely encloses and protects the inside.

Multi-angle kickstand

Logitech carries a multi-angle kickstand built in to the rear protective cover. The kickstand, including immunity, can be adjusted up to a max of 50-degrees to help achieve optimum viewing angles.

The kickstand works great for table-top operation, and you can do a fairly good job of letting you lap type. The viewing angles necessary for a comfortable typing position might result in a lap typing experience, but to my sitting position\.

Clearly you are not likely to have as good of a lap typing experience as you would with a conventional notebook such as the MacBook Air, but by finessing the flexible stand an individual can make it work.

Smart connector support is fantastic

One of the best features of the Combo Touch is its addition of connections in order to take advantage of one of those iPad 7’s new Smart Connector functionality. Smart Connector support on the iPad 7 allows users to immediately power and set peripherals like Apple’s Smart Keyboard, and Logitech’s Combo Touch Keyboard Case.

The presence of the Smart Connector means that you’ll never need to think about flaky Bluetooth pairing or batteries within the keyboard running out of juice. The 7 powers directly the computer keyboard itself, which greatly simplifies the process of using an external keyboard.

Versatility

Logitech designed the Combo Touch Keyboard Case in a way which allows users to make the most of four distinct usage modes. There is the conventional mode for typing, one for a sketching mode, a manner that is reading, and also viewing\. This is another way of stating that the keyboard cases adjusts in various ways to help alleviate the current task at hand and folds.

Another wonderful feature is the built in Apple Pencil/Logitech Crayon holder. I can’t tell you how often I’ve lost my Apple Pencil so I love having the ability to store it straight.

Security comes at a price

Logitech’s Combo Touch not just protects front and sides of the iPad, but it shields the back as well. Once the case is closed in reality, the iPad is protected, corner to corner.

Of course, such protection comes at the cost of a slim and trim package. The 7 is a rather thin device on its own, but it transforms into a hefty bundle that’s much thicker than the exact same iPad when mated with Apple’s Smart Keyboard when incorporating the Logitech Combo Touch.

The case also adds a significant quantity of weight to the package, weighing in at more than the iPad itself . 43 pounds. ) Coupled with the 1. 07 pound iPad 7, it is a total weight of 2.5 lbs. To place that weight into perspective, the 2020 MacBook Air weighs 2.8 lbs.

For those that love the idea off using a Smart Connector-power computer keyboard and trackpad, but can not get past the bulk, it’s possible to use just the keyboard portion of the package without the back protective case.

The drawback of such a decision is that you’ll want to use something to prop up the iPad since you lose the adjustable kickstand. In the instance in the video, I used the Slope from WipLabs, which can be an all round excellent iPad standalone.

I believe I could get away with the Logitech Combo Touch Keyboard sans case when only using it round the home, but I would probably need both the protection and the adjustable kickstand provided from the rear cover when out and about.

Trackpad characteristics

The key feature that divides the Logitech Combo Touch Keyboard Case from additional iPad 7 computer keyboard cases is its inclusion of a built-in trackpad with multi-touch gesture support. Having such a feature built in means that you don’t have to rely on an outside Bluetooth Magic Trackpad or even Magic Mouse in order to use the magnificent new cursor performance in iPadOS 13.4.

The upper surface of the trackpad is apparently glass, exactly like the trackpad you’ll find in a MacBook, but the surface area is a lot less than what you’ll discover on a Mac. It may feel a bit cramped when you’re utilized to using a standalone or laptop Trackpad.

Another big difference between this trackpad and only discovered on contemporary Apple laptops has to do with click enter. Clicking on the surface causes the trackpad to physically move in order for your click actuation to register As it employs a mechanical diving board layout\.

Modern-day Apple laptop trackpads are solid state in nature, so the clicking is simulated and the trackpad itself doesn’t actually move when clicked. \Country trackpads’ advantage\ is that there are no dead zones, which means you may click anywhere to register a click.

Using a mechanical trackpad, like the one in the Logitech Combo Touch, you will come across dead zones near the top, since the clicking mechanism is positioned close to the bottom. In effect, it makes for less usable space for clicking.

For this reasonI highly recommend enabling the Tap to Click change found in Preferences → General → Trackpad. This will allow you to simply tap on the surface to enroll clicks, which \gives more usable surface area\.

Overall I’m a big fan of having a trackpad that’s always there and ready to use. As I mentioned in our hands on summary of the best trackpad features in iPadOS 13.4, having cursor support on the iPad allows for more precise control. Since you have to reach up and touch the screen editing text is easier, and browsing across the OS is easy due to its gestures.

Within my hands on time, I’ve noticed a few bugs using the Logitech Combo Touch trackpad. This will be addressed via the LogitechControl companion program that can help facilitate firmware upgrades.

For example, when scrolling pages in Safari, I notice”slippage” when utilizing two-finger scrolling. This results in the page to suddenly stop moving, together with the cursor moving rather\.  And when employing the tap secondary click on right-clicking the gesture will neglect to enroll.

Both of those bugs are bothersome, but neither of these happen frequently enough to make me not want to use the trackpad. Again, those are \problems which may be addressed using a firmware update later on\.

Keyboard experience

The Logitech Combo Touch includes well-spaced keys that offer sufficient visual feedback and essential travel to be in a position to comfortably type long-form content.

The keys on the keyboard are also backlit, making it simpler to sort in dimly-lit environments. The keyboard backlight can be controlled directly from the function row, which also features other iPadOS shortcuts keys, like the capability to visit the Home display, adjust quantity, invoke Spotlight search, etc.. There are four distinct backlight amounts from which to pick from.

LogitechControl, the above companion app for facilitating firmware updates, includes keyboard backlight management preferences. Via this company program, you can change the backlighting length from 5 seconds up to 60 minutes, and change the rate where the lights fade off after inactivity.

9to5mac’s Require

Provided that you are obtaining a Smart Connector-powered backlit computer keyboard and integrated trackpad with multi-touch gesture support, adding all this functionality to your iPad for just $149. 95 feels just like pretty good thing.

The largest drawback to this Logitech Combo Touch Keyboard Case is the majority, which is excellent for protecting your iPad 7, but otherwise is a bit much. You may attempt using the keyboard with no own case, if you’re adamant about staying thin and light, but you lose performance in the procedure\.

That having been said, this keyboard has whetted my appetite for Apple’s official Magic Keyboard alternative for the iPad Pro. That keyboard appears to add functionality without much of the bulk that is additional we see here, but in addition, it is double the price, and demands a Guru to use it.

If you have an iPad 7 and you’re seeking to take full advantage of trackpad aid in macOS, I believe the Logitech Combo Touch Keyboard Case is a solid choice. It’s a terrific way to turn your iPad 7. It’s bulky while utilizing the rear cover, but I think, if you can get beyond the majority iPad 7 owners will be quite happy it.
